Python для начинающих

Хотите научиться программировать на Python без сложных терминов? Этот курс — как друг, который объяснит тему на примере коробки с яблоками или списка покупок. Здесь нет воды, только практика, понятные шаги и подготовка к ЕГЭ. Попробуйте!
Начальный уровень
4-5 ч в неделю

Чему вы научитесь

  • Ожидаемые результаты
  • +Уверенное владение Python на уровне, достаточном для решения задач ЕГЭ и реальных проектов.
  • +Умение применять алгоритмическое мышление для решения задач любой сложности.
  • +Готовность к успешной сдаче ЕГЭ по информатике с акцентом на программирование.
  • +Навыки работы с библиотеками и инструментами Python для анализа данных и автоматизации задач.
  • Курс подходит как для начинающих, так и для тех, кто хочет углубить свои знания и подготовиться к экзаменам.

О курсе

Ключевые особенности:
Простота и доступность

  • Объяснения через аналогии из жизни (кортежи = запертая коробка, списки = блокнот).

  • Минимум теории, максимум практики.

Пошаговая структура

  • Каждая тема разбита на небольшие шаги (например, «Условные операторы → Циклы → Генераторы списков»).

  • Акцент на повторяемости: от простых примеров к сложным.

Практическая направленность

  • Задания с автоматической проверкой на Stepik.

  • Примеры из реальной жизни (список покупок, дни недели, координаты на карте).

Подготовка к ЕГЭ

  • Разбор задач, аналогичных экзаменационным (работа с файлами, строками, алгоритмами).

Основные темы курса:

  1. Базовый синтаксис: переменные, операторы, ввод/вывод.

  2. Управляющие конструкции: if-else, циклы (for, while), break/continue.

  3. Структуры данных: списки, кортежи, генераторы списков.

  4. Методы работы с данными: строки, файлы, базовые алгоритмы.

  5. Подготовка к ЕГЭ: типовые задачи на программирование.

Платформа и методика:

  • Stepik (выбор обоснован бесплатностью, русскоязычной аудиторией и поддержкой автоматической проверки кода).

  • Упор на интерактивность: ученики сразу видят результат своих решений.

Фишки курса:

  • Методически выверенные задания (от простого к сложному).

  • Аналогии из жизни для лучшего понимания абстрактных концепций.

  • Гибкость: подходит как для самостоятельного изучения, так и для работы в классе.

Для кого этот курс

Целевая аудитория: Начинающие ученики (включая слабую подготовку). Школьники, готовящиеся к ЕГЭ по информатике. Преподаватели, ищущие структурированные материалы.

Начальные требования

1. Базовые навыки работы с компьютером:

  • Умение открывать/сохранять файлы, работать с браузером.

  • Опыт ввода текста в редакторах (например, Блокнот или Word).

2. Минимальная математическая подготовка:

  • Знание арифметики (+, -, *, /).

  • Понимание простых логических условий («больше», «меньше»).

3. Технические требования:

  • Доступ к компьютеру с интернетом.

  • Установленный Python 3.x (или возможность использовать онлайн-интерпретатор, например, Trinket).

  • Браузер для работы на Stepik (Chrome, Firefox, Edge).

4. Психологическая готовность:

  • Желание учиться и пробовать новое, даже если сначала непонятно.

  • Готовность делать ошибки и исправлять их (это часть обучения!).

Что НЕ требуется:

  • Опыт программирования (курс рассчитан на новичков).

  • Углубленные знания математики.

  • Дорогое ПО — все инструменты бесплатны.

Проверьте себя:
Если вы можете:

  1. Создать папку на рабочем столе.

  2. Написать в Google: «Как установить Python».

  3. Решить пример: «Если x = 5, чему равно x + 3?» — вы готовы к курсу!

Совет: Не пугайтесь, если что-то кажется сложным — курс начинается с самых основ, и каждый шаг будет разобран подробно.

Наши преподаватели

Как проходит обучение

Курс построен по принципу «минимум теории — максимум практики» и подходит даже для тех, кто никогда не программировал.

1. Формат занятий

  • Короткие текстовые объяснения (3–5 минут) с простыми аналогиями.
    Пример: «Переменная — это как коробка с названием, куда можно положить число или текст».

  • Интерактивные задания на Stepik с автоматической проверкой кода.

  • Живые примеры из жизни: списки покупок, погода, игры.

2. Практика: тесты и кодинг

  • Тесты на понимание после каждого блока:
    Пример: «Что выведет этот код?» → варианты ответов.

  • Задания на написание кода с постепенным усложнением:

    1. Простое повторение: Напишите код, который выводит «Привет, мир!».

    2. Доработка готового кода: Добавьте условие в программу.

    3. Решение с нуля: Напишите калькулятор для двух чисел.

  • Подсказки и исправление ошибок:

    • Если код не работает, система укажет на ошибку.

    • Пример: «Ошибка: вы забыли двоеточие после if».

Программа курса

загружаем...

Что вы получаете

  • После курса вы не просто узнаете синтаксис Python — вы сможете:
  • ✔ Автоматизировать рутинные задачи (например, переименовать 100 файлов).
  • ✔ Решать задачи ЕГЭ на программирование быстрее одноклассников.
  • ✔ Писать код, который работает с первого раза!
  • Бонус: Для самых упорных — рекомендации, куда двигаться дальше (веб-разработка, анализ данных, игры).
Price: Бесплатно

Расскажите о курсе друзьям

Price: Бесплатно